what was the main effect of poll taxes and literacy test put in place in the south at the end of the 19th century

The poll tax and the literacy test were only two of various ways to prevent blacks from voting. The literacy test had the biggest effect, due to Black not knowing how to read in general. What they would do is give a written paper in front of the voter, then say "read this" or "read this in German" or any other language of that.
